The Inspector General President Obama appointed to oversee spending of our tax dollars in Afghanistan is still at work under President Trump. He continues to uncover extraordinary waste. Here’s my report that first aired in August 2017 on the wasted hundreds of billions on “ghost soldiers.”
Check out my New York Times bestseller: “The Smear.”
Was President Obama the ultimate authority bearing responsibility for no IG during Clinton’s entire tenure as Secretary of State?